Update the rzv2h_wdt driver to fetch clock configuration and timeout
parameters from device tree match data rather than relying on hardcoded
constants. Introduce a new structure rzv2h_of_data that encapsulates
minimum and maximum clock select values (cks_min and cks_max), clock
divider (cks_div), timeout cycle count (timeout_cycles), and the
timeout period select bits (tops). These values are provided through
the OF match table and retrieved via of_device_get_match_data() during
probe.

This change allows dynamic configuration of the watchdog timer for
different SoCs, such as the RZ/T2H, which require different settings.
